Output 83996beaefffe0776c60cc85f7a17d61f5d8dd09ff6d3d5ecdb5c05dc87b8088:11

value
12484678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1420cddd9c84d7cfeb6619afa96b718f2447de53 OP_EQUAL
address
33XSjero68hVajif4SC1LHwYoWA16fyAyZ
transaction
83996beaefffe0776c60cc85f7a17d61f5d8dd09ff6d3d5ecdb5c05dc87b8088
spent
true